clarkio
I 💙 Web Development, Application Security, Automation and VS Code. Developer Advocate. Author at Pluralsight. Previously @Microsoft, @Disney.
Pinned Repositories
angular-i18n
Internationalization in Angular
azure-mask
A browser extension (Chromium, Firefox) that toggles concealment of sensitive information found in the Azure Portal web page such as Subscription Id's
ios-favorite-movies
A sample application to find and save a list of your favorite movies
macos-wifiname
Display the currently connected WiFi name (SSID) in the menu bar on macOS
modern-npm-package
An npm package for demonstration purposes using TypeScript to build for both the ECMAScript Module format (i.e. ESM or ES Module) and CommonJS Module format. It can be used in Node.js and browser applications.
node-web-push
An example Node.js server using Web Push
streaming-guide
An (incomplete) guide to getting into streaming (mostly for programming)
ttv-chat-bot
Twitch livestream bot that can control colors for overlays from Stream Elements, play sound effects, handle custom rewards (like text-to-speech) and more!
vscode-twitch-highlighter
This is a VS Code extension that will allow your Twitch chat to highlight a line of code via a command message. Example: `!line 8 server.js`. See master branch README.md for more details
vulnerable-app
[DEPRECATED] A sample web application using Node.js, Express and Angular that is vulnerable to common security vulnerabilities.
clarkio's Repositories
clarkio/vscode-twitch-highlighter
This is a VS Code extension that will allow your Twitch chat to highlight a line of code via a command message. Example: `!line 8 server.js`. See master branch README.md for more details
clarkio/ttv-chat-bot
Twitch livestream bot that can control colors for overlays from Stream Elements, play sound effects, handle custom rewards (like text-to-speech) and more!
clarkio/macos-wifiname
Display the currently connected WiFi name (SSID) in the menu bar on macOS
clarkio/stream-note-taker
A tool that will help record stream events and notes while live streaming
clarkio/chakeyra
A live streaming game where the streamer and viewers in chat compete to typing challenges
clarkio/secure-node-server
A Node.js server template that's secure by default and comes with some simple boilerplate setup.
clarkio/clarkio.github.io
Clarkio website
clarkio/pdfjs-vuln-demo
This project is intended to serve as a proof of concept to demonstrate exploiting the vulnerability in the PDF.js (pdfjs-dist) library reported in CVE-2024-4367
clarkio/vscode-authentication-twitch
Twitch Authentication Provider for VS Code
clarkio/cert-sig-alg
Retrieves the certificate signature algorithm for a set of hosts using OpenSSL
clarkio/clarkio.com-uptime
📈 Uptime monitor and status page for Brian Clark, powered by @upptime
clarkio/modern-nodejs-runtime-features-2024
clarkio/nodejs-goof
Super vulnerable todo list application
clarkio/simple-node-server
A simple Node.js server to run in Azure
clarkio/sproutkit
Apps and Components for Twitch Overlays
clarkio/tau
TAU- Twitch API Unifier, a containerized relay/proxy to unify the WebHook- and WebSocket-based real-time Twitch APIs under a single (local) WebSocket connection.
clarkio/ai-code-security
A demo app to use with AI code tools for showing how they can generate vulnerable code
clarkio/ai-youtube-reporter-tool
AI built YouTube reporting tool for testing purposes
clarkio/blank-nodejs-codespace
clarkio/discord-wordle-bot
A clarkio community specific Discord bot to track wordle game results
clarkio/dotfiles
idk what I'm doing but I'm trying this
clarkio/DSOF-Patch-Todo-App-Java
clarkio/face-cam-scene-switcher
clarkio/github-actions-environment-variables
clarkio/llm-ai-security-demo
clarkio/package-json-exports
clarkio/ssrf-in-nodejs
clarkio/stream-overlays
My static stream overlays and assets
clarkio/stream-tools
clarkio/THM-Snyk-Code